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ll send a team to your home to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to address the issue. This includes identifying the source of the water, determining the extent of the damage, and developing a strategy for removal and drying. Expert assessment is crucial to ensuring that the job is done right.
Step 2: Water Removal
Our crew will use specialized equipment to remove standing water from your home. This includes powerful pumps, wet vacuums, and other tools designed to get the job done quickly and efficiently. Fast water removal is critical to preventing further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the standing water is removed, our team will focus on drying and dehumidifying your home. This includes using specialized equipment to remove moisture from the air and surfaces, and monitoring the environment to ensure that everything is dry and safe. Moisture control is key to preventing mold and mildew grow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
After the drying process is complete, our team will focus on cleaning and disinfecting your home. This includes removing any remaining moisture, cleaning and disinfecting surfaces, and ensuring that your home is safe and healthy. Thorough cleaning is essential to preventing the spread of mold and mildew.

Warning Signs You Need Emergency Water Extraction
Catching the signs of water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ors that linger in your home can be a sign of water damage. If you notice a musty smell that won’t go away, it’s time to call in the experts. Don’t ignore the smell – it could be a sign of mold and mildew growth.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ice that your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s time to call in the experts. Don’t delay – the longer you wait, the more damage you’ll face.
Stains on the Ceiling or Walls
Stains on the ceiling or walls can be a sign of water damage. If you notice stains that won’t go away, it’s time to call in the experts. Don’t ignore the stains – they could be a sign of a bigger problem.
Water Stains on the Carpet or Pad
Water stains on the carpet or pad can be a sign of water damage. If you notice water stains that won’t go away, it’s time to call in the experts. Don’t delay – the longer you wait, the more damage you’ll face.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ice peeling paint or wallpaper, it’s time to call in the experts. Don’t ignore the signs – they could be a sign of a bigger problem.
Swollen or Cracked Trim
Swollen or cracked trim can be a sign of water damage. If you notice swollen or cracked trim, it’s time to call in the experts. Don’t delay – the longer you wait, the more damage you’ll face.
